Kevin Smith heads to Riverdale for Archie Meets Jay and Silent Bob crossover

March 10, 2025 by Gary Collinson

Pop culture icons will collide in July as Kevin Smith teams with Archie Comics to bring the View Askewniverse to Riverdale with the oversized one-shot comic book crossover Archie Meets Jay and Silent Bob.


“I believe it was Stoic philosopher Epictetus who first said, ‘Everything’s Archie.’ And he was right,” said Smith. “Whether it be Veronica in Clerks or the Mister Weatherbee conversation in Chasing Amy, the influence of Archie Andrews is mixed into the brick and mortar of my pop cultural foundation. So, there was no way I was passing up this incredible opportunity to collide the worlds of Riverdale and the Askewniverse, and introduce icons on the order of Archie, Betty, Veronica, Jughead, Moose, Reggie, and Josie to reprobates like Jay and Silent Bob.”

“Archie Meets Jay and Silent Bob is a crossover like we’ve never done before! Kevin has brilliantly brought two legendary, generation-defining worlds together to tell a story that’s so funny, totally wild, and also heartfelt and moving,” said Archie Comics’ Jesse Goldwater, who was instrumental in making the project happen. “Kevin Smith — a true genius — tells a story that feels both quintessentially View Askewniverse and classically Archie, honoring the incredible legacies of these beloved iconic characters. I cannot wait for readers to check out what I believe is going to be the greatest crossover in the history of entertainment!”

“I couldn’t be happier that the first crossover Secret Stash Press has ever done is with Jesse and the good folks at Archie Comics,” added Smith. “Everything’s Archie, and Archie is everything.”

Archie Meets Jay and Silent Bob will go on sale on July 9th.
